TPS612564CYFFT by Texas Instruments

TPS612564CYFFT by Texas Instruments is a switching regulator with a max output voltage of 5.4V and a control mode of current-mode PWM. It operates in industrial temperature grades, making it suitable for applications requiring precise power management in harsh environments. With a compact package style and low profile design, this regulator is ideal for space-constrained electronic devices.

Feature Benefit Bullets

Package Body Material: PLASTIC/EPOXY

Plastic and epoxy materials provide durability and protection for the internal components of the switching regulator.

Surface Mount: YES

Being surface mountable makes the regulator easy to integrate into PCB designs, saving space and improving overall layout efficiency.

No. of Terminals: 9

Having 9 terminals allows for versatile connections and configurations, providing flexibility in design and functionality.

Maximum Operating Temperature: 85 °C

With a high maximum operating temperature, this product can withstand demanding environmental conditions, ensuring reliable performance.

Control Mode: CURRENT-MODE

Current-mode control offers improved transient response and better noise immunity, leading to stable and efficient operation.

Terminal Finish: Tin/Silver/Copper (Sn/Ag/Cu)

The use of a high-quality terminal finish enhances the product's conductivity and reliability, ensuring consistent performance over time.

Width (mm): 1.206 mm

The compact width of the regulator allows for space-saving designs, ideal for applications where size constraints are a concern.

Maximum Switching Frequency: 3500 kHz

A high switching frequency enables fast response times and efficient power delivery, making this product suitable for high-performance applications.

Nominal Output Voltage: 5.4 V

The stable and precise output voltage of 5.4 V ensures consistent power delivery, enhancing the overall performance of connected devices.

Texas Instruments

Texas Instruments Inc. (TI) is one of the world's leading semiconductor companies and a global leader in analog and digital signal processing technology. The company has had a major impact on the electronics industry for over 80 years, manufacturing integrated circuits (ICs), software and subsystems that leverage high-performance computing capabilities. It offers an extensive portfolio of solutions for a wide range of industries, from aerospace to medical devices and consumer products to communication systems. Over its long history, TI has become synonymous with quality, reliability and innovation. Today, TI is one of the largest semiconductor companies in the world with operations in more than 30 countries across six continents.
